    Sorry for your loss. Your story sounds similar to mine. Sounds like it is possible it could be done. I agree with PP about testing. when I MC naturally there wasn't a ton of blood except for right before I would pass a larger clot. Then it would slow down again. For me the cramping came in waves like what I assume contractions feel like. It lasted 5 hours and when I passed the sac I felt relief from the pain/cramps. After that it was just bleeding/spotting/stuff like you described for a week.
